The Silk Road train takes passengers on a journey through some of the most historically significant and culturally rich countries in Central Asia The route typically starts in Moscow, Russia, before making its way through Kazakhstan, Uzbekistan, and Turkmenistan, eventually reaching its final destination in Beijing, China Along the way, travelers have the opportunity to visit ancient cities, UNESCO World Heritage Sites, and experience the diverse landscapes and vibrant cultures of the region.
One of the main attractions of traveling on the Silk Road train is the opportunity to visit cities that played a crucial role in the ancient Silk Road trade In Uzbekistan, passengers can explore the historic cities of Samarkand, Bukhara, and Khiva, which were once important centers of trade and culture along the Silk Road These cities are home to stunning examples of Islamic architecture, including intricate mosques, madrasas, and mausoleums that date back centuries.
In Kazakhstan, travelers have the chance to visit Almaty, the country’s largest city and cultural capital Almaty is known for its modern skyline, bustling markets, and proximity to the snowy peaks of the Tien Shan Mountains For those interested in history, a visit to the Charyn Canyon in southeastern Kazakhstan offers a glimpse into the country’s natural beauty and geological wonders.
Turkmenistan is another highlight of the Silk Road train journey, with its unique blend of ancient history and modern development The capital city of Ashgabat is known for its grandiose architecture, including the iconic Independence Monument and the Turkmenistan Tower, which offers panoramic views of the city Travelers can also visit the ancient city of Merv, a UNESCO World Heritage Site that was once a major center of trade and culture along the Silk Road.
